Here are the groups for today's kickoff of ESL's South East Europe Championship Season 1.
A total of 13 qualifiers were held to put together all 16 teams taking part in the South East Europe Championship, which will hand out $2,200.
Even though one season of the SEE Championship already took place, this is the first with an offline finals, which will be held during the East European Comic Con in Bucharest on May 9-10.

Two teams advance from each group into online playoffs, which will determine three teams going to the offline finals, while the last slot will go to a wild card team from the hosting country, Romania.
